World Rational Quote by Dean Koontz
““The world was a maze of mysteries and puzzles, but it was a world of rational design that did not present puzzles without answers. There was always an answer.””
About This Quote
Source Novel: The Darkest Evening of the Year, Dean Koontz, 2011
The world is designed rationally, offering answers to every puzzle, implying an underlying order.
In simple terms: The universe provides answers to all puzzles.
